Jewish Family Service of Orange County
Using Statamic to empower a great Non-Profit
Jewish Family Service of Orange County, NY (JFS). Their previous website was 12 years old and lacked the ability to be updated easily. They were using a WordPress website, which inundated them with too many options. For the layperson, it was too much to handle, which left them unable to update the website on their own. Counter-intuitive to the idea of a Content Management System (CMS).
